Planning and task management in older adults: Cooking breakfast

From: Memory & Cognition | Date: September 1, 2006| Author: Bialystok, Ellen; Craik, Fergus I M | Copyright information

The article describes a simulated "cooking breakfast" task in which participants must remember to start and stop cooking five foods so that all the foods are "ready" at the same time. In between starting and stopping operations, the participants also carried out a "table-setting" task as a filler activity. The breakfast task yields various measures of multitasking and executive control. Groups of younger and older adults performed the task; half of the participants in each group were bilingua...
